Why Supplements Matter for Cognitive Health
1. The brain’s nutrient needs are unique
The human brain uses ~20% of our resting energy and relies on a specific set of nutrients — omega-3 fatty acids, B-vitamins, antioxidants, and certain amino acids — to maintain membrane integrity, neurotransmitter synthesis, and mitochondrial function. When diet alone doesn't supply consistent amounts or when absorption declines with age, supplements fill gaps. How Natural Supplements Support Brain Biology
Membrane structure and omega-3s

Methylation, homocysteine, and B-vitamins
Vitamin B12 and folate regulate homocysteine; elevated homocysteine is associated with cognitive decline. Older adults often need B12 supplementation due to absorption issues. We’ll provide evidence-based dosing later.
Inflammation, oxidative stress and botanicals
Chronic low-grade inflammation and oxidative stress accelerate neuronal damage. Compounds like curcumin, polyphenols, and certain adaptogenic botanicals exert anti-inflammatory and antioxidant effects in preclinical and clinical studies. Top Natural Supplements for Memory & Focus (What the Evidence Says)
1. Omega-3 fatty acids (DHA & EPA)
Evidence: Meta-analyses indicate DHA-rich supplementation can improve memory and executive function in older adults with mild cognitive impairment (MCI). Mechanism: membrane fluidity, anti-inflammatory eicosanoids, and neurogenesis support.
Practical note: For cognitive endpoints, aim for ~1,000–2,000 mg combined EPA+DHA daily from high-quality fish oil or algal DHA for vegans. 2. Bacopa monnieri
Evidence: Multiple randomized controlled trials show Bacopa improves memory consolidation with 300–450 mg daily standardized to 20% bacosides over 12 weeks. Mechanisms include cholinergic modulation and antioxidant effects.
Practical note: Benefits are gradual; expect measurable effects after 8–12 weeks. Consider pairing with a B-complex if mood or energy deficits coexist.
3. B-vitamins (B12, B6, folate)
Evidence: Supplementing B12 and folic acid reduces brain atrophy rates in some trials when baseline homocysteine is elevated. B-vitamins support neurotransmitter synthesis and brain methylation.
Practical note: Use methylated folate (5-MTHF) if MTHFR variants are known. For symptomatic B12 deficiency, sublingual or intramuscular forms are often used; oral high-dose cyanocobalamin or methylcobalamin can work for maintenance.
4. Ginkgo biloba
Evidence: Mixed. Some studies show modest benefits for cognitive function in older adults; effects are more consistent for subjective cognitive complaints and circulation-related cognitive issues. Standardized extracts (EGb 761) at 120–240 mg/day are most studied.
Caution: anticoagulant interactions — discuss with prescribers.
5. Curcumin (turmeric extract)
Evidence: Curcumin formulations designed for bioavailability show cognitive benefits in small trials, likely due to anti-inflammatory and antioxidant activity. Doses of 500–1,000 mg/day (enhanced bioavailability formulations) are typical.

6. Lion’s Mane (Hericium erinaceus)
Evidence: Preliminary human trials and animal studies suggest benefits for cognitive function and nerve growth factor stimulation. Typical doses in studies are 1,000–3,000 mg/day of extract.
Practical note: Effects may be subtle and require sustained use; best used as part of a holistic plan including cognitive training.
Interpreting the Research: What Good Studies Look Like
Randomized, placebo-controlled trials with clinical endpoints
High-quality studies randomize participants and use cognitive batteries (memory, attention, executive function). When reading summaries, prioritize trials that report clinically meaningful effect sizes and longer durations (12–52 weeks).
Biomarker and imaging support strengthen claims
Studies using MRI, PET, or blood biomarkers (e.g., homocysteine, inflammatory markers) provide mechanistic support. Be cautious with studies that only use subjective scales without objective measures.
Reproducibility and meta-analyses

Dosage, Timing, and Safety: A Practical Playbook
General dosing principles
Start low and titrate up to evidence-based doses. Many botanicals require weeks to months for benefits. Always document baseline medications — fish oil, B-vitamins and herbs can interact with anticoagulants, anticonvulsants and antidepressants.
Timing and synergy
Take fat-soluble compounds (curcumin, omega-3s) with meals that contain some fat. Pair cholinergic-supporting herbs with activities that require focused learning for synergy. Choosing High-Quality Brain Supplements
Look for third‑party testing and standardized extracts
Choose products with testing from USP, NSF, or ConsumerLab. Standardization (e.g., Bacopa 20% bacosides, curcumin as BCM-95 or Meriva) ensures consistent active-compound levels. For herb-focused starter kits and tools, see Your Herbal Toolkit.

Practical Stacks: How to Build a Safe, Evidence-Based Brain Regimen
Core daily stack for adults focused on prevention
DHA 1,000 mg/day; B-complex with B12 (methylcobalamin 500–1,000 mcg if deficient), and a multivitamin providing baseline micronutrients. Add a standardized Bacopa (300 mg/day) if memory concerns exist. Track response with simple cognitive diaries over 12 weeks.
Stack for mild cognitive worry or MCI
Consider higher-dose DHA (1,000–2,000 mg), B-vitamin regimen targeted to correct elevated homocysteine, and either curcumin (bioavailable form) or Bacopa. Coordinate with a clinician for monitoring; if vascular factors are present, consider Ginkgo carefully under supervision.
Stacking for busy professionals seeking focus
Lower-dose omega-3s, adaptogens (e.g., Rhodiola for acute stress; evidence modest), and choline precursors (alpha-GPC or citicoline) for short-term attention support. Special Considerations: Age, Comorbidities, and Caregivers
Older adults and absorption issues
Age-related changes reduce absorption of B12 and vitamin D. Consider sublingual B12 or checking serum levels before and during supplementation. Caregiver strategies for monitoring benefit
Use baseline cognitive checklists, photo or video journals, and objective tests (clock-draw, 3-word recall) to detect changes. Consider small controlled trials at home: introduce a single supplement, monitor for 12 weeks, and document changes before adding another ingredient.
Comparison Table: Key Supplements, Evidence & Practical Dosing
| Supplement | Evidence Grade | Typical Dose | Main Benefit | Primary Cautions |
|---|---|---|---|---|
| Omega-3 (DHA + EPA) | A (good RCT/meta-analyses in MCI) | 1,000–2,000 mg/day | Memory, membrane health, anti-inflammatory | Fish allergies, anticoagulants, product purity |
| Bacopa monnieri | B (multiple RCTs) | 300–450 mg/day (20% bacosides) | Memory consolidation | GI upset, long onset time |
| B-vitamins (B12, folate, B6) | B (conditional on deficiency) | B12 500–1,000 mcg/day if low; folate 400–800 mcg | Methylation, homocysteine reduction | Masking B12 deficiency with folate; interactions |
| Curcumin (bioavailable) | B (promising RCTs) | 500–1,000 mg/day (enhanced absorption) | Anti-inflammatory, cognitive protection | GI upset; interacts with anticoagulants |
| Ginkgo biloba (EGb 761) | C (mixed results) | 120–240 mg/day | Circulation-related cognitive support | Anticoagulant interactions; variability in extracts |
| Lion's Mane | C (early human trials) | 1,000–3,000 mg/day | Neurotrophic support | Limited long-term safety data |
Quality Control, Label Literacy, and Red Flags
Reading a Supplement Label
Check active ingredient amounts, standardization, serving size, and filler ingredients. Avoid proprietary blends without disclosed quantities. If labels mention exotic delivery systems, verify independent evidence.
Red flags in marketing
Ignore miracle claims, celebrity endorsements without data, and promises of immediate cures. For a take on how content and hype evolve, read consumer-behavior reflections in A New Era of Content.
When to consult a professional
If you have multiple medications, liver disease, pregnancy, or complex cognitive symptoms, consult a clinician. Complex medication interactions are a common reason to pause self-directed stacking.

FAQ
1. Which supplement has the strongest evidence for memory support?
Omega-3 fatty acids (DHA/EPA) and B-vitamins for people with elevated homocysteine have the strongest and most consistent evidence for supporting memory and slowing brain atrophy in at-risk populations.
2. Can I take multiple brain supplements at once?
Yes, but introduce one at a time and allow 8–12 weeks to evaluate effect. Watch for interactions (e.g., Ginkgo with blood thinners) and coordinate with clinicians when on multiple medications.
3. Are botanical supplements safe for older adults?
Many are safe, but older adults often have altered pharmacokinetics. Start at lower doses, verify product quality, and consult healthcare providers, especially if on multiple prescriptions.
4. How long before I notice benefits?
It varies: some compounds (e.g., citicoline) may show short-term attention effects, but many botanicals like Bacopa and curcumin need 8–12 weeks or longer to show measurable cognitive benefits.
5. Are there natural supplements to reverse dementia?
No supplement reliably reverses dementia. Evidence supports prevention strategies and slowing decline in at-risk groups. Work with clinicians for comprehensive care plans that may include evidence-based supplements as adjuncts.
